Jump to content

Featured Replies

comment_172970

Или SVG всегда расширяет шапку? Ее ни как не сделать как на скрине представленном выше черно-белый.

 

  • Replies 55
  • Просмотров 11,3k
  • Created
  • Последний ответ

Лучшие авторы в теме

Most Popular Posts

  • Хочется ругаться матом! Ребяты, у вас уже яйца седые, но вы не знаете, что аттрибуты width и height могут быть только в виде "30" и "30%"? Никаких '30px', '1.2em' и прочей лабуды из css. 

  • zmaker ничего сложного. Открываешь файл свг текстовым редактором, копируешь оттуда весь код и вставляешь его в Global - logo, после <a href='{setting="base_url"}' id='elLogo' accesskey='1'>

  • Захотелось обновить форум с SVG лого.  Почитал две страницы боли в теме. Обновлять перезахотелось.

Posted Images

comment_172971

Скорее всего достаточно у svg указать max-height: XXpx

comment_172972
2 минуты назад, Respected сказал:

Скорее всего достаточно у svg указать max-height: XXpx

Прошу прощения, не совсем дошло?
 

На данном этапе стоит вот


{{if \IPS\Theme::i()->logo['front']['url'] !== null }}
{{$logo = \IPS\File::get( 'core_Theme', \IPS\Theme::i()->logo['front']['url'] )->url;}}
 <a href='{setting="base_url"}' id='elLogo' accesskey='1'>
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N" "http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<!-- Creator: CorelDRAW X6 -->
<svg xmlns="http://www.w3.org/2000/svg" xml:space="preserve" width="57mm" height="99mm" version="1.1" style="shape-rendering:geometricPrecision; text-rendering:geometricPrecision; image-rendering:optimizeQuality; fill-rule:evenodd; clip-rule:evenodd"
viewBox="0 0 21000 29700"
 xmlns:xlink="http://www.w3.org/1999/xlink">
 <defs>
  <style type="text/css">
   <![CDATA[
    .fil0 {fill:#FEFEFE}
   ]]>
  </style>
 </defs>
 <g id="Слой_x0020_1">
  <metadata id="CorelCorpID_0Corel-Layer"/>
     <path class="fil0" d="M7049 9344l1126 -1126 4579 0 1126 1126 0 4798 -976 -536 0 -3807 -606 -606 -3668 0 -606 606 0 2238 1952 1072 0 4019 977 0 0 -1267 976 536 0 1707 -2929 0 0 -4427 -1952 -1072 0 -3262zm6832 5910l0 3676 -1126 1126 -4579 0 -1126 -1126 0 -5212 976 536 0 4221 606 606 3668 0 606 -606 0 -2652 -1952 -1073 0 -1103 2927 1608zm-2927 -2719l0 -1389 -977 0 0 852 -976 -536 0 -1292 2929 0 0 2901 -976 -536z"/>

 </g>
</svg>
</a>
{{endif}}

Отсюда и вопрос, не совсем понял, куда это вставить max-height: XXpx ?

  • Author
comment_172974
12 минут назад, zmaker сказал:

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N" "http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<!-- Creator: CorelDRAW X6 -->

А это то откуда взялось???

comment_172977

Блокнотом открыл SVG там это

<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N" "http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<!-- Creator: CorelDRAW X6 -->
<svg xmlns="http://www.w3.org/2000/svg" xml:space="preserve" width="210mm" height="297mm" version="1.1" style="shape-rendering:geometricPrecision; text-rendering:geometricPrecision; image-rendering:optimizeQuality; fill-rule:evenodd; clip-rule:evenodd"
viewBox="0 0 21000 29700"
 xmlns:xlink="http://www.w3.org/1999/xlink">
 <defs>
  <style type="text/css">
   <![CDATA[
    .fil0 {fill:#FEFEFE}
   ]]>
  </style>
 </defs>
 <g id="Слой_x0020_1">
  <metadata id="CorelCorpID_0Corel-Layer"/>
  <path class="fil0" d="M7049 9344l1126 -1126 4579 0 1126 1126 0 4798 -976 -536 0 -3807 -606 -606 -3668 0 -606 606 0 2238 1952 1072 0 4019 977 0 0 -1267 976 536 0 1707 -2929 0 0 -4427 -1952 -1072 0 -3262zm6832 5910l0 3676 -1126 1126 -4579 0 -1126 -1126 0 -5212 976 536 0 4221 606 606 3668 0 606 -606 0 -2652 -1952 -1073 0 -1103 2927 1608zm-2927 -2719l0 -1389 -977 0 0 852 -976 -536 0 -1292 2929 0 0 2901 -976 -536z"/>
 </g>
</svg>

 

  • Author
comment_172979

zmaker на форуме как воспроизвести проблему? Не вижу этой темы в списке выбора. В противном случае никак не помочь, либо только если повеситься

comment_172980
18 минут назад, the.bunin сказал:

zmaker на форуме как воспроизвести проблему? Не вижу этой темы в списке выбора. В противном случае никак не помочь, либо только если повеситься

Тема доступна в подвале наз-ся тест.

  • Author
comment_172983
35 минут назад, zmaker сказал:

<svg xmlns="http://www.w3.org/2000/svg" xml:space="preserve" width="210mm" height="297mm" version="1.1" style="shape-rendering:geometricPrecision; text-rendering:geometricPrecision; image-rendering:optimizeQuality; fill-rule:evenodd; clip-rule:evenodd"
viewBox="0 0 21000 29700"
 xmlns:xlink="http://www.w3.org/1999/xlink">

Эмм, у нас в вэбе размеры указываются в пикселях (px), а не в миллиметрах (mm). Поэтому так всё и уехало

comment_172984
3 минуты назад, the.bunin сказал:

Эмм, у нас в вэбе размеры указываются в пикселях (px), а не в миллиметрах (mm). Поэтому так всё и уехало

Это в самом SVG выставлять mm?

  • Author
comment_172985
2 минуты назад, zmaker сказал:

Это в самом SVG выставлять mm?

Я скопировал фрагмент кода, где миллиметры нужно поменять на пиксели.

comment_172987
4 минуты назад, the.bunin сказал:

Я скопировал фрагмент кода, где миллиметры нужно поменять на пиксели.

Подскажите пожалуйста, в каком элементе поменять?

  • Author
comment_172988

Мля, ребят, я так больше не могу...либо он стебётся, либо реально настолько "мозг не хочет включать". Ничего личного. Но я умываю руки и больше даже не зайду в эту тему, с меня хватит

comment_172989
3 минуты назад, the.bunin сказал:

Мля, ребят, я так больше не могу...либо он стебётся, либо реально настолько "мозг не хочет включать". Ничего личного. Но я умываю руки и больше даже не зайду в эту тему, с меня хватит

Мне заняться больше что ли нечем, как стебяться?
Надо нормально пояснить, для чего форум?
Если вы такой умный, давайте я вам дам тех задание по графике и нарисуйте чего либо?
Или например корел, если не работаете в нем, ни когда с первого раза, ни чего не получиться, сложно пояснить, сразу нервы, какие то.
Если такие нервы, то я не знаю, как жить с ними, это равно сильно учитель в школе если ребенок не понимает, сразу выгонять в спецшколу или еще чего?
Вот, все у меня выставлено, где еще чего менять то? Вот мне больше делать нечего, как дурковать, я реально не вьеду, где еще смотреть?

<svg xmlns="http://www.w3.org/2000/svg" xml:space="preserve" width="57mm" height="99mm"

comment_172992

Вам уже сказали, у свойств width и height не может быть значений с параметром "mm", только числа или числа с %

comment_172993
3 минуты назад, Desti сказал:

Вам уже сказали, у свойств width и height не может быть значений с параметром "mm", только числа или числа с %

Ну как еще объяснить, убрал я mm <svg xmlns="http://www.w3.org/2000/svg" xml:space="preserve" width="57" height="99"  логотип превратился в крошечный, ну что еще не так то, а потом говорят я глумлюсь.  Проблема то не решилась.
 

comment_172996
2 минуты назад, by_ix сказал:

а % где? 

или пиксели хотя бы. 

Поставил % все равно шапка через одно место.
Как я не менял % что бы я не делал, все равно все плывет.
Ставишь меньше, вообще нет слов...

2046664013_-2.thumb.jpg.f8ef79f18ee34b693f1ef13bf2857950.jpg

А потом мне говорят я туплю, да я уже все перепробовал.

comment_172997

Захотелось обновить форум с SVG лого. 
Почитал две страницы боли в теме.
Обновлять перезахотелось.

comment_172999

Сам сожалею, что спросил, получил один негатив. Вообще раз в 100 лет зайдешь спросить, сразу шквал негатива, ну что это за подход, равно сильно посадить того, кто ни когда не умел водить машину, а тупо наехать на него, сказать не твое и все, в итоге, ни какой помощи не получил, один негатив и сожаление о том, что просто спросил один раз.
Я просто в полном ауте.

comment_173000
12 minutes ago, zmaker said:

Сам сожалею, что спросил, получил один негатив. Вообще раз в 100 лет зайдешь спросить, сразу шквал негатива, ну что это за подход, равно сильно посадить того, кто ни когда не умел водить машину, а тупо наехать на него, сказать не твое и все, в итоге, ни какой помощи не получил, один негатив и сожаление о том, что просто спросил один раз.
Я просто в полном ауте.

Кроме общих вводных о взаимокультуре общения также нужно понимать, что это не платная служба поддержки, которая будет делать все, чтобы вы получили свой ответ и захотели "у них" что-то еще покупать. На форумах бесплатной помощи все по другому :) 

comment_173001
1 минуту назад, SINILIAN сказал:

Кроме общих вводных о взаимокультуре общения также нужно понимать, что это не платная служба поддержки, которая будет делать все, чтобы вы получили свой ответ и захотели "у них" что-то еще покупать. На форумах бесплатной помощи все по другому :) 

Нет, это все понятно, дело то не в этом, я спросил, но в итоге получил просто негатив.
Вот как выше мне пишут, сменить на пиксели,  width="57px" height="99px"  сменил, а толку, это называется я глумлюсь?
Это уже походу надо мной глумятся, я спросил, ни чего не ответили бы да и все, зачем меня вводить в заблуждение и раздувать из мухи слона.
Не помогли бы, да и не надо, пнг поставлю, а зачем было эту флудильню на ровном месте разводить?
Полный абсурд.

comment_173002

с заданными пикселями у тебя походу рабочая область svg больше картинки. При помощи css можно подогнать, но не думаю что это правильный вариант:
 

<svg xmlns="http://www.w3.org/2000/svg" xml:space="preserve" width="57px" height="99px" version="1.1" style="shape-rendering:geometricPrecision;text-rendering:geometricPrecision;image-rendering:optimizeQuality;fill-rule:evenodd;clip-rule:evenodd;margin-top: 15px;transform: scale(3);" viewBox="0 0 21000 29700" xmlns:xlink="http://www.w3.org/1999/xlink">
 <defs>
  <style type="text/css">
   
    .fil0 {fill:#FEFEFE}
   
  </style>
 </defs>
 <g id="Слой_x0020_1">
  <metadata id="CorelCorpID_0Corel-Layer"></metadata>
     <path class="fil0" d="M7049 9344l1126 -1126 4579 0 1126 1126 0 4798 -976 -536 0 -3807 -606 -606 -3668 0 -606 606 0 2238 1952 1072 0 4019 977 0 0 -1267 976 536 0 1707 -2929 0 0 -4427 -1952 -1072 0 -3262zm6832 5910l0 3676 -1126 1126 -4579 0 -1126 -1126 0 -5212 976 536 0 4221 606 606 3668 0 606 -606 0 -2652 -1952 -1073 0 -1103 2927 1608zm-2927 -2719l0 -1389 -977 0 0 852 -976 -536 0 -1292 2929 0 0 2901 -976 -536z"></path>

 </g>
</svg>

 

comment_173003
24 минуты назад, ZIKURIK сказал:

с заданными пикселями у тебя походу рабочая область svg больше картинки. При помощи css можно подогнать, но не думаю что это правильный вариант:
 

<svg xmlns="http://www.w3.org/2000/svg" xml:space="preserve" width="57px" height="99px" version="1.1" style="shape-rendering:geometricPrecision;text-rendering:geometricPrecision;image-rendering:optimizeQuality;fill-rule:evenodd;clip-rule:evenodd;margin-top: 15px;transform: scale(3);" viewBox="0 0 21000 29700" xmlns:xlink="http://www.w3.org/1999/xlink">
 <defs>
  <style type="text/css">
   
    .fil0 {fill:#FEFEFE}
   
  </style>
 </defs>
 <g id="Слой_x0020_1">
  <metadata id="CorelCorpID_0Corel-Layer"></metadata>
     <path class="fil0" d="M7049 9344l1126 -1126 4579 0 1126 1126 0 4798 -976 -536 0 -3807 -606 -606 -3668 0 -606 606 0 2238 1952 1072 0 4019 977 0 0 -1267 976 536 0 1707 -2929 0 0 -4427 -1952 -1072 0 -3262zm6832 5910l0 3676 -1126 1126 -4579 0 -1126 -1126 0 -5212 976 536 0 4221 606 606 3668 0 606 -606 0 -2652 -1952 -1073 0 -1103 2927 1608zm-2927 -2719l0 -1389 -977 0 0 852 -976 -536 0 -1292 2929 0 0 2901 -976 -536z"></path>

 </g>
</svg>

 

Все отлично!
Спасибо большое!

comment_173004

Хочется ругаться матом! Ребяты, у вас уже яйца седые, но вы не знаете, что аттрибуты width и height могут быть только в виде "30" и "30%"? Никаких '30px', '1.2em' и прочей лабуды из css. 

comment_173005

zmaker не переживай, не у всех нервы железные) Будь проще, не воспринимай всё настолько критично. 

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.


Guest
Ответить в этой теме...

Последние посетители 0

  • No registered users viewing this page.